Abstract

A dumbbell and incremental weight plate for same comprise a bar that extends generally axially between opposing end regions, a weight plate mass mounted about the bar at each end region, and at least one incremental weight plate mountable on the dumbbell. The weight plate mass and the incremental weight plate have respective magnetic regions that cause the incremental weight plate to be selectively magnetically secured to the weight plate mass or to be magnetically repelled from the weight plate mass to assist the user in removing the incremental weight plate from the dumbbell.

Claims (15)

1. A dumbbell comprising:

a bar that extends generally axially between opposing end regions,

a weight plate mass permanently secured to the dumbbell about the bar at each end region, the axially outermost surface of each weight plate mass having at least one magnetic region having a magnetic pole facing axially outward; and

means for retaining the mounted weight plate mass at the respective end regions to define a handle region axially inward of the end regions that can be gripped by a user during exercise movement of the dumbbell.

2. The dumbbell of claim 1 further including an incremental weight plate sized to be mounted on the axially outermost surface of the weigh plate mass, the incremental weight plate having at least one magnetic region positioned to face axially inward when the incremental weight plate is mounted on the dumbbell so that the incremental weight plate is magnetically repelled from the weight plate mass when at least a portion of the at least one magnetic region of the incremental weight plate generally overlies at least a portion of the at least one magnetic region of the weight plate mass.

3. The dumbbell of claim 1 further including an incremental weight plate mounted for rotation about the bar at least one end region and having an axially inwardly-facing magnetic pole positioned to selectively couple magnetically to the at least one magnetic region of the weight plate mass when the incremental weight plate is rotated about the bar into a removal position to thereby magnetically repel the incremental weight plate from the weight plate mass.

4. The dumbbell of claim 1 wherein the bar extends axially outward of the weight plate mass at each end region sufficiently to accept a generally annular incremental weight plate having a generally central through hole that accommodates the bar.

5. The dumbbell of claim 1 wherein the weight plate mass at each end region has a pair of magnetic regions positioned generally diametrically opposite about the bar.

6. The dumbbell of claim 5 further including a generally annular incremental weight plate having a generally central bar-accommodating through-hole and sized to be mounted on the axially outermost surface of the weight plate mass, the incremental weight plate having a pair of magnetic regions positioned to be at diametrically opposite side of the bar and to face axially inward when the incremental weight plate is mounted on the dumbbell.

7. A dumbbell comprising:

a bar that extends generally axially between opposing end regions,

a weight plate mass mounted about the bar at each end region,

means for retaining the mounted weight plate mass at the respective end regions to define a handle region axially inward of the end regions that can be gripped by a user during exercise movement of the dumbbell, and

at least one incremental weight plate mountable on said weight plate mass,

the weight plate mass and the incremental weight plate having respective magnetic regions that cause the incremental weight plate to be magnetically secured to the weight plate mass when the incremental weight plate is not in a decoupling position, and that cause like magnetic poles associated with the weight plate mass and the incremental weight plate to repel the incremental weight plate from the weight plate mass when the incremental weight plate is rotated about the bar into the decoupling position.
